It wasn’t a totally smooth ride. The montage is full of spectacular hits and a few hilarious misses. When you feed ancient tape into a modern neural network, you run into two main perils:

  • Hallucinations: No, the AI hasn’t been eating funny mushrooms. In tech speak, this happens when the AI tries to “guess” what a blurry shape is and confidently invents details that never existed. (Think: a smudged hand suddenly getting six fingers, or a shadowy bush turning into a creepy face.)
  • Artifacts: These are glitchy digital leftovers. Imagine random blocky pixels, unnatural flickering, or weird halos floating around people. It’s what happens when the software gets confused by Y2K-era webcam compression.AI Magicx

But when you hit the sweet spot, it works absolute miracles. Software like Topaz Video AIAiarty, and the AI features in DaVinci Resolve are incredible at smoothing out grain and rescuing lost details.

The secret trick? The prompt. You have to tell the AI exactly what to fix and what to leave alone. I actually got an AI to write the perfect restoration instructions for me.

I’ve pasted that exact prompt below. Feel free to steal it for your own time-traveling edits!

Restore and upscale this low-resolution webcam image to true 4K quality. 
Treat this as a forensic restoration, not a creative generation. Preserve the person’s identity, facial structure, expression, age, skin texture, hairline and all visible features exactly as they appear in the source image. 
Recover detail only where there is clear visual evidence. Do not guess or invent missing information. If eye colour is unclear, keep it neutral rather than guessing. If facial hair is uncertain, do not create it. If any detail is ambiguous, preserve the ambiguity rather than hallucinating new features. 
Remove compression artefacts, webcam noise, pixelation and blur while maintaining a natural photographic appearance. Improve sharpness, colour accuracy, contrast and lighting without changing the subject or scene. 
Do not beautify, stylise, age, de-age, smooth skin, alter facial proportions, add facial hair, add makeup, change clothing details, change the background, or introduce any new elements. 
The final result should look exactly like the original photograph captured with a modern professional 4K camera, not a different photograph of the same person.
